Contour Asset Management LLC boosted its position in BILL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:BILL – Free Report) by 45.5%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The fund owned 4,710,570 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,472,132 shares during the quarter. BILL accounts for 6.0% of Contour Asset Management LLC’s holdings, making the stock its 4th largest holding. Contour Asset Management LLC’s holdings in BILL were worth $256,914,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

BILL Company Profile
BILL Holdings, Inc provides financial automation software for small and midsize businesses worldwide. The company provides software-as-a-service, cloud-based payments, and spend management products, which allow users to automate accounts payable and accounts receivable transactions, as well as enable users to connect with their suppliers and/or customers to do business, eliminate expense reports, manage cash flows, and improve office efficiency. It also offers onboarding implementation support, and ongoing support and training services.
